By the River

南塔瓦‧努班查邦 Nontawat Numbenchapol 
2013 | 泰國 Thailand | 71 min | 台灣首映 Taiwan Premiere
 

在泰國西部北壁府,一片密林深處的村落「閣里地」,當地居民以捕魚維生,世世代代與河並存,過著與世無爭的簡樸生活。然而某一日,礦產公司進駐,河流開始變化,肉眼看不見的物質潛藏伏流,寧靜的河流依舊清澈,但日子再也不同……。一位年輕男子每天潛入大河為愛人捕魚,某一天,河流吞噬了他,而他的愛人仍急切地等待他的歸來。本片以精簡的敘事手法,靜謐而風格化的攝影風格,勾勒出自然、工業、人相互依存的矛盾本質。

A story of Karen villagers whose lives are upended by ecological disaster. Amidst the tranquility of the deep woods, the residents of Klity, in Kanchanaburi, Thailand, have always led a simple life. They used to feed on the fish populating the town’s creek, but for some time now the river has been contaminated by a mineral processing factory. A young local man dives every day to catch fish for his lover, but one day he goes missing. Meanwhile, the lover eagerly awaits his return.
